Eligibility

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Children aged 5 to 20 years Diagnosis of unilateral anisometropic amblyopia (more than 2 lines difference in BCVA between eyes) Best corrected visual acuity (BCVA) in the amblyopic eye between 6/12 and 6/60 No prior amblyopia treatment or treatment discontinued at least 6 months ago Parents/guardians willing to provide informed consent

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Presence of strabismus Bilateral amblyopia Ocular pathology (e.g., cataract, retinal disease) Neurological or developmental disorders affecting vision therapy compliance Inability to attend follow-up visits

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Change in Best Corrected Visual Acuity (BCVA) in amblyopic eye (measured with LogMAR chart)Timepoint: 4 months after either of the intervention

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Improvement in stereoacuity (Randot test or similar) Parental compliance with therapy (logbook review) Number of patients improved more than 3 line of visual acuity. Contrast sensitivity Timepoint: Baseline (Week 0) Week 4 (for optical saturation) Week 8 Week 12 Week 16
